Save Money on Toner

Gary North - September 20, 2005

I use a lot of toner. At almost $50 per cartridge, I am always looking for a way to save money on toner.

A good way to cut back on costs is to set your printer on "light" or "draft" mode. You don't have to have it letter quality all the time.

I have also found a way to buy myself an extra 200 pages for free.

With my HP LaserJet 1100, the cartridge starts to go bad before all the toner is gone. Here is the tell-tale sign: the letters in the middle of the page, top to bottom, start getting pale. Pretty soon, they fade away.

When this happens, I remove the toner cartridge, go over to the sink, extend the cartridge horizontally, and vigorously shake it back and forth about five times. This redistributes the toner inside the cartridge. Toner gets stuck on the ends of the cartridge. Shaking the cartridge evens it out. Then I put the cartridge back in the printer.

When I forget to buy a spare cartridge, this gives me a couple of days to get to the local Office Depot to buy a new cartridge.

Warning: sometimes flecks of toner escape when you shake it. This is why you should shake the cartridge over a sink.

I go to Office Depot to buy more toner cartridges. I buy their in-house brand. They give me a ream of paper in exchange for an empty toner cartridge. They make money on the cartridge, I suppose. Also, they know that I will probably buy a new cartridge from them. Once I'm in the store, I'm a hot sales prospect. That's why they have a limit of one exchange per trip.
